Can-Am 705009508 Front Facia OEM for 2017-2020 Maverick X3 MAX Turbo XDS RR

Can-Am 705009508 Front Facia OEM for 2017-2020 Maverick X3 MAX Turbo XDS RR

SKU: FHZ.04950 705009508 Category: Tag: